Reviewing of child deaths

Reviewing child deaths is a statutory requirement for local safeguarding partnerships in England.  The purpose of the processes is to try to understand how a child has died and then put in place interventions to protect other children and prevent future deaths, wherever possible. 

It is intended that the Child Death Review process will:

  • document and try to understand the cause of death, so that parents/carers and the wider family can come to terms with the death of their child
  • enable parents/carers and professionals to take steps to prevent the deaths of any other children where possible
  • identify patterns of deaths in a community, so that preventable or avoidable hazards that may contribute to deaths can be recognised and reduced
  • contribute to the improved collection of forensic evidence in the very small proportion of deaths where there might be concerns about the cause of death being non-accidental
  • work together to co-ordinate the review of child deaths and share learning to help safeguard children across Cumbria

Case Review

The purpose of a Case Review is to receive notifications from agencies or professional or Child Death Overview Panel (CDOP) of a serious incident. The Case Review group collects and collates information on each child and seeks relevant information from professionals and family members. Where a suspicion arises that neglect or abuse may have been a factor in the child’s death, referring a case back to the CSCP Independent Scrutineer for consideration of whether a child Safeguarding Practice Review (SPR) is required.
